## Key Ceremony Checklist — Item 7

Before signing the Paylark release keys, verify that the flaky integration tests in the settlements suite have been quarantined, not deleted; the ceremony record must note each skipped test and its tracking reference. Two witnesses must initial the quarantine list. Once confirmed, unseal the ceremony workstation to proceed — it is protected by the recovery passphrase recorded immediately below.

vault phrase of bagaf-kajeg = jorath-feniel-briir-siliel-ralix

**Ticket: Config drift on DeployParrot**

DeployParrot, the chat bot that posts deploy status, reports stale environments in the ops channel. Staging config was hand-edited and no longer matches the repo. Reconcile before the next release window. Do not edit live values directly; update the repo and redeploy. The expected production configuration is as follows.

service settings:
PRAIX_LOG_LEVEL=error
PRAIX_METRICS_HOST=metrics.praix.qorvelcorp.corp
PRAIX_POOL_SIZE=16

* Invalidation is event-driven for price and stock changes, so this TTL
 * only exists as a backstop when the Finchway event bus drops a message.
 * Raising it saves origin load but lengthens the worst-case staleness
 * window shoppers can see after a merchandising update; lowering it below
 * sixty seconds has caused origin saturation during past sale events.
 * Coordinate any change with the release cut. The validated build token
 * for the current value is recorded below.
 */

build token for kagaf-hahof: htk14_9d3d4d26d7d8de

Subject: DR drill — MatchPoint GC pauses

Hi Verena,

During Thursday's disaster-recovery drill, the MatchPoint matching service showed garbage-collection pauses up to 1.8s during failover replay. We'll tune heap sizing before the next run and capture full GC logs. To restore the drill snapshot, the standby vault must be unsealed with the passphrase below.

unlock words, hafop-tahog: drumir-druiel-kasox-wenax-tamys-frair